Record and linked web site Growth:
Online poker surfaced inside late 1990s as a consequence of breakthroughs in technology together with net. 1st internet poker area, Planet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a tiny but enthusiastic neighborhood. But was at early 2000s that internet poker practiced exponential development, primarily as a result of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
